Laying the Odds
Laying the Odds is betting that a 7 will be rolled before the point.
If the point is a 4 or 10 the don't odds pay 1:2.
If the point is a 5 or 9 the don't odds pay 2:3.
if the point is a 6 or 8 the don't odds pay 5:6.
The amount you may win by laying odds is the product of your don't
pass bet and the multiple of odds allowed per the table rules. If
the table allows five times odds then you can win five times your
don't pass bet by laying odds. Note that the multiple applies to
how much you can win, not how much you can bet. For example if you
bet $2 on the don't pass and the table allows full double odds then
you can bet $8 to win $4 on a point of 4 or 10, $6 to win $4 on
a point of 5 or 9, and $6 to win $5 on a point of 6 or 8.

Come
If you have ever become bored waiting for a point to be thrown
and didn't want to waste your money on the sucker bets to guarantee
a money flow on every throw, then you should try the come bet. It
is like the pass line bet but may be made at any time. Like the
pass line bet you may also put money on the odds if a point is thrown
on the first roll after the come bet is placed and has a house edge
of 1.41%.
There is a nuance to the come bet the player should know about.
If a point is thrown and there are still active come bets on the
table waiting for a different point, then special rules apply for
the following come out roll. The come out roll will still apply
to active come bets but it will not apply to their respective odds
bets, unless it is requested to leave the odds "on." In
the event a come bet is resolved on a come out roll then the odds
bet will be returned.
Good Craps strategies for the player who likes constant action
is to have a new bet on either the pass line or come on every throw,
and to always take the maximum allowable odds.
Don't Come
The relationship of the "don't pass" to the "pass",
is the same relationship as the "don't come" to the "come".

The Place Number Bets
In craps the 4,5,6,8,9, and 10 are known as the "place numbers."
For the player who must have money on some or all of them immediately,
they may make certain bets to cover any place number(s) they desire.
These bets work just like the odds but pay worse odds, with the
exception of the "hard way" bets which are described below.
Like odds bets on top of come or don't come bets, place number bets
are turned off on a come out roll.
